Transaction 035e3d707029e238f4436a19746dc11501e45dc2009995327701748bbebc31d1

1 Input
2 Outputs
  • 035e3d707029e238f4436a19746dc11501e45dc2009995327701748bbebc31d1:0
  • value  416100
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3
  • 035e3d707029e238f4436a19746dc11501e45dc2009995327701748bbebc31d1:1
  • value  451975191
    address  3FfQg564J2XCEJukbnMVNjRwoac1fySzWx